Self esteem or self worth is defined as, “Your assessment of your worth or value reflected in your perception of such things as your skills, abilities, talents, and appearance” (Beebe, 40). Communication enhances self-esteem because effectively conveying a message in the adequate intended manner can help boost self worth. When one can effectively communicate, one then can reach a conscious decision that they have made a positive impact by reflecting on how their communication was perceived and if it reached the intended goal. This goes hand in hand with self-awareness. If one is self-aware they then can boost their self-esteem by always assessing the situation correctly. Communication is inescapable meaning society always uses and always will need communication to advance. Society will always be advancing so will communication models and ways of communicating.
Communication is irreversible meaning anything you say cannot be taken back. That is almost true in any situation, but in todays technology anything you post or send is forever out there forever.
Communication is complicated meaning communication is not an easy idea or notion to capture. If communication was simple then the world would be a peaceful place, but different ideas, languages, and cultures are going to conflict communication and make it complex.
Communication emphasizes content and relationships meaning how you say something can mean more than what you say. Your engagement and tone can portray a lot during the communication model.
Communication is governed by rules meaning that there are general accepted rules in communication.
